PRAIRIE CREEK EPM 26852

(APPLICATION)

➢ Tenement covers numerous historical occurrences

  • f gold mineralisation associated with Grandore

granitic complex and Camboon Volcanics of the Auburn Arch. ➢ Located in established mineral province, between Theodore/Cracow (80km to S in same belt of rocks: 2 Moz Au) and Mt Morgan (9 Moz Au). ➢ Encompasses prospective area now recognised for both low and high sulphidation styles of epithermal gold mineralisation and porphyry gold and copper mineralisation. ➢ Heads of Agreement with Capgold Pty Ltd, which provides 9% free carried interest up to BFS.

➢ EL 8568 is 100% held by Duke and associated with porphyry style copper-gold mineralisation, within the Lachlan Fold Belt. ➢ Targeting Cadia look-alikes (37 M oz Au, 7.5 .5 Mt Cu). ). ➢ Surface results including 0.1 .17% Cu, , 11.5 .5 g/t Au support base metal and gold mineralisation . ➢ Historical workings highlight potentially multiple mineralisation styles including skarn, epithermal and VMS which may be related to buried porphyry intrusive sources. ➢ Magnetic images reveals a number of circular and sub-circular magnetic anomalies indicative of buried intrusions, (porphyries) and associated potential epithermal and skarn targets. ➢ These will be the focus of 3D data analysis targeting prior to drilling.

COOMERANG EL 8539

➢ EL 8539 lies near the Gilmore Suture Zone, 5-15 km south of

the Adelong Gold Field.

➢ The Gilmore Suture Zone is a major geological

structure traversing the Lachlan Fold Belt and is associated with significant gold endowment.

➢ Specifically associated with:

  • Mineral Hill (1 Moz)
  • Cowal (6 Moz)
  • Gidginbung/Temora (4 Moz)
  • Adelong/Mt Adrah (1 Moz)

➢ EL 8539 contains untested drill targets associated with

historical gold workings, identified along 12 km+ strike length within the tenement.
